GBBuyer Beware ZML is a rip off, they are not upfront about costs, lots of the downloads are actually pirated straight out of movie theaters. All ways to contact them usually end in "error" They "membership" is charged out under a different name each month, so looking at bank receipts they all look different, and generally the charges differ also. I too signed up for what I thought was a one day trial, and then discovered two months later I was billed for a full "membership" each month even though I had been inactive since I discovered the first day what they offered. I tried to contact them, but to no avail. Buyer Beware

GBA garbage outfit!! Company's product, processes & procedures stink: they advertised a $.99 video download...After several tries I was able to get 60 Mb of a 700 Mb download! On the same day I notified the Company regarding the problem and told them to cancel the transaction/membership, etc.! I received an e-mail a day later telling me about a "1 month extension" and a $39.50 charge on my "statement"...They must be out of their **#$! minds!! I'll be contacting: FCC, BBB, State's Atty's office & possibly any other agency that comes to mind!!!!

GBMust I award one star? This company doesn't deserve even one star it is a SCAM! Plain and simple bait and switch. They charge you and you can't even download their crap. I even wonder about the legitimacy of the movies. "LQ" (low quality), you've got to be kidding me. "LQ" is just another word for "CAM", you know, the crappy movies that some scumbag records with a CAMcorder in a theater. They had "The Book of Eli" and "Legion" available in LQ. No studio distributes their movies to other commercial channels while they're being shown in theaters. I wonder what the FBI would think about their movie collection especially the "LQ" rated ones.
